web框架问题汇总
二开单据表格翻页全选框异常,检查是否为表格数据行id重复导致的分页问题,多分录下行id(rowid)需配置标识列为id+分录id。
分录F7编辑后失去焦点未清除F7编辑器:editCell列下标值计算逻辑有误,更新web框架补丁
85以上导出表格数据先全选后反勾选部分行,导出的excel存在空白数据行:更新web框架补丁
配置页面打开前台报错cannot read property 'createDOMFun' of undefined:断点调试下是哪个控件没注册,在配置页面->模块->勾选所要创建的组件->确定->保存。如上述操作后还是报错则需检查waf-ctrl-all.js、waf-ctrl-min.js是否存在相应的控件注册代码,如果没有则可能是文件被替换,根据补丁文件更新即可。
web多分录表格导出重复:web表格只显示单头列但query中添加了分录列导致,更新web框架补丁
扩展开发平台打开配置页面,扩展复制页面等报stream ForbiddenClassException:更新第三方包导致,更新web框架补丁
编辑单据保存时不想刷新页面:_self.setOnlyModelLoad(true)
单据打开提示没有权限:到GUI用户管理分配对应的权限并同步权限数据
列表页面快速查询搜索字段由query的字段属性isQuickSearchField决定
web端数据最多仅查询10万条:修改server\profiles\server1\config\bosconfig.xml
11.查找元数据:
单据ID获取bosType:D840369D
获取实体包路径:com.kingdee.bos.metadata.MetaDataLoaderFactory.getLocalMetaDataLoader(ctx).getEntity(com.kingdee.bos.util.BOSObjectType.create("D840369D"))
获取元数据包路径:com.kingdee.bos.dao.xml.impl.MDLoader.getInstance().cl.getResource("com/kingdee/eas/fdc/sales/app/SignManage.entity")
12.表格取数接口传参条件修改:扩展表格的serializeGridData事件,修改postData对象
13.冻结表格区域不允许滚动
14.多组织下导出表格excel无报错但打开是空的,排查导出接口是否未传mainorgunit、mainorgtype参数导致引擎查询数据为空,确认是该原因后更新web框架补丁
15.从第三方系统单点登录到EAS系统时候XXXsso.jsp访问404:配置apusic白名单(apusic\domains\server1\config\web.xml的serverNameWhiteList)
16.隐藏编辑页面内置的云之家分享按钮:修改server\deploy\easweb.ear\eas_web.war\WEB-INF\properties\waf2.properties的yzjshare为false
17.获取F7显示的值:$.wafPromptBox.format(waf("#f7").wafPromptBox("getValue"),"{displayName}")
18.修改分录F7过滤条件:waf("#entries").wafGrid("getColumnConfig","expenseType").editoptions.subTagJson.filterItem=""
获取单元格配置:waf("#editGrid").wafGrid("getCellConfig", "column", "rowid");
修改单元格F7过滤条件:waf("#entries").wafGrid("setCellEditorAllConfig","column","filterItem",filterItem,"wafPromptStandard",rowid)
F7赋值:表头的话用wafXXX("setValue"),分录F7用表格的setCell,eg:
var rowid="Xs06CytARFOBeiPIq0qFvfXE6MU=";
var columnName = "editGrid_expenseTypeColumn";
var freeType = {"id":"M8jt/c8rR+64XV9aKNrjUXjkvJQ=","name":"员工福利费"}; waf("#grid").wafGrid("setCell", rowid, columnName, freeType);
web框架问题汇总
本文2024-09-22 20:02:45发表“eas cloud知识”栏目。
本文链接:https://wenku.my7c.com/article/kingdee-eas-111101.html